Man Remanded For Impersonating Magistrate In Kwara

Date: 2023-01-03

A magistrates' court sitting in Ilorin, Kwara State, has remanded one Bolaji Babaita for allegedly impersonating a judge.

The Ilorin branch of the Nigerian Bar Association (NBA), sued Babaita for allegedly impersonating magistrate Imam Babatunde Popoola to defraud members of the public.

According to a direct complaint filed by Barr Taofiq Olateju on behalf of the NBA, the defendant (Babaita) specialised in impersonating, forging and procuring landed property documents with fraudulent intent using the name of the magistrate.

Olateju urged the court to order the defendant's remand, saying it would serve as a deterrent to others from perpetrating such act.

Magistrate Abdulraheem Bello, who presided over the matter, granted the request and ordered the defendant's remand in the federal correctional facility.

He adjourned the case to January 19.
